Electronic Arts (EA) Tops Q1 EPS by 63c, Beats on Revenue; Offers FY25 Revenue Guidance
July 30, 2024 4:09 PM EDTElectronic Arts (NASDAQ: EA) reported Q1 EPS of $1.04, $0.63 better than the analyst estimate of $0.41. Revenue for the quarter came in at $1.26 billion versus the consensus estimate of $1.21 billion.
